Not fully a true description of that street. You're considering three or four blocks "The Hood". You have to be a person that never really lived in that specific area to really understand the people who live there. There's mainly a bunch of elderly people, churches ,and a Head start school there. That specific place is where we gathered for holidays/celebrations, funerals, and community prayer, and let's not forget community give backs and actually take care of the homeless. It was hard to own a home while black back in the days. Where else do you think black families were able to live because it was racial systematics of white zone and black zone. So to you may seem like a hood but to us is history. But I guarantee you if, you just come without your goggles of judgment. Twigg Streets will offer you a plate and a whole lot of love. The people are beautiful and kind there. Every place has its up and down. But try to figure out the whole story not just a bits of pieces of it.
Brooksville is a very weird town to me. It’s so huge in terms of land that you’d be seeing different types of areas. U have downtown Brooksville, then u have the area off the Suncoast, which is more coastal-like, then u have the area off I 75 which is mostly rural. Im surprised not many ppl know about or live in Brooksville, cuz it takes up 75% of Hernando County like a fat lump
